The sizing is kind of all over the place to be honest. I have owned / tried on about a half dozen models, some have fit a bit narrower than sized, some bigger than sized, some TTS. My verdict is it's a crapshoot, but ymmv. As far as the shoes go styling wise, they're also hit and miss (though less misses than Paul Smith) but if you get the right ones they're awesome.

I ordered a pair from Yoox on their last day of sale (March 31st). Still waiting for them to arrive. They were at a fair price (98 euros) and Yoox kept adding discounted models (returns?) at the end of last month. If you're patient, you can find them on discount at Yoox in a few weeks.

I tried a few pairs in Italy recently and they were TTS, but a bit ellongated and narrow. Some of their models look ridicoulous in the photos, but more normal in real life.
